Husqvarna W 70 P Slurry Vacuum with Discharge Pump - 967664701

W 70 P is a powerful industrial wet and slurry vacuum designed for the toughest jobs. This is achieved by using high quality stainless steel components and a special combination of filter and float that protects the motor. Where most wet vacs can only handle water, W 70 P can deal with liquids such as concrete slurry, oils and machining coolants. Recommended for concrete drilling, sawing, grinding and wall/wire sawing. Ingenious solutions make W 70 P easy to work with. Pumping out can take place at the same time as suction. Emptying is carried out via a large bottom valve for simple cleaning.

Features
  • Toughest jobs a slurry vacuum can handle
  • Manage liquids such as concrete slurry, oils and machining coolants
  • Integral stainless steel strainer screens gravel from the slurry to protect the pump impeller
  • Powerful evacuation pump is capable of pumping the slurry 33 ft vertically or 656 ft horizontally
  • Patented filter/float system provides maximum airflow and reliable wet shut-off in case of overfill
  • Stainless steel container, crush-proof hose, cast aluminum swivel hose lock, galvanized steel dolly and steel clamps for tight air seal for a long service life
  • Integral stainless steel strainer screens gravel from the slurry to protect the pump impeller
  • Welded frame enables easy transportation by resting the machine on the frame
  • Non-marking wheels are puncture-free and lock at the front
  • Includes: 1.5" x 10' hose, 3-piece wand and floor tool
Specifications
MPN 967664701
Power Supply 1-phase
Voltage 120V
Power 1.6 hp (1.2 kW)
Max Rated Current 16.7 amps (10A vac & 6.7A pump)
Gallon Capacity 15 gal (56 L)
Airflow 118 CFM
Water Lift 90"
Pump Water Lift 30"
Pump Discharge 63 gal/min (238 L/min)
Dimensions 24" x 22" x 49" (600 x 570 1,250 mm)
Weight 99 lb (34 kg)

Maintenance Tips
  • Always disconnect power before maintenance to avoid electrical hazards.

  • After each use, empty and clean the tank through the bottom valve to remove slurry buildup.

  • Flush the pump and hoses with fresh water after pumping slurry to prevent clogging and hardening.

  • Inspect and clean the filter and stainless steel strainer regularly; replace if damaged.

  • Visually check the float device that protects the motor; ensure it’s free from obstructions.

  • Inspect hoses, clamps, and seals for wear or cracks; tighten or replace as needed.

  • Clean the external surfaces and air passages with a damp cloth (avoid high‑pressure wash).

  • Lock front wheels during transport and handle hoses carefully to prevent damage.

  • Store in a dry environment to protect electrical and mechanical components.

  • Follow the operator manual for periodic professional service and scheduled part replacements.
